Kevin Challen, 55, from Worthing, sent the message to a child while serving a ten-month suspended sentence after indecent images of children were found on his computer in March 2021.

The member received a suspended sentence and was placed on the sex offenders’ register for ten years subject to special restrictions under a Sexual Harm Prevention Order (SHPO).

While serving a suspended sentence, Chellen breached the terms of his SHPO and, through lies and deception, befriended unsuspecting family friends and began texting the 12-year-old.

The child was brave enough to inform his parents of the extent of Chelen’s illicit contact with them, and this led to Chelen being arrested again by Sussex Police.

Following an investigation, Chelen was charged with three offenses of breaching his SHPO, as well as failing to comply with sex offender registry notifications.

Challen pleaded guilty to the offenses and appeared at Lewes Crown Court on Wednesday March 15 for sentencing, where he was jailed for 31 months and his SHPO was changed to an indefinite one.

Criminal Detective Constable Dawn Hosken said: “I would like to thank the victims for their bravery in coming forward and the witnesses for their support in this case. A member convicted of a sex crime is now in prison.”
